Back in May there were Linux kernel patches posted as a workaround for Arm CPU errata around the Speculative Store Bypass(SSB) handling. The Linux workaround to this newer errata is to have a speculation barrier after MSR writes to the SSBS register. Thus with Linux 6.11 the code will land for expanding this speculative SSBS workaround to the additional affected models.
